Story & heritage
The Suede Chelsea Boot keeps the boot silhouette but changes the mood. The softer surface makes the Common Projects ankle boot feel less formal while preserving the brand's spare outline.
It belongs in the icon set because it shows how the brand repeats one minimal grammar across sneaker and boot categories.
Materials & craft
END. presents this version as a suede Chelsea with elasticated panels, pull tab and rubber outsole. The gold side stamp remains the identifying Common Projects detail.
How to choose & style
Suede softens black denim, flannel trousers and knitwear. Keep it away from heavy rain and use it when texture matters more than shine.
